Pro Fisherman Has $15K in Equipment Stolen from Truck in Lufkin

Lufkin Police are reporting that a professional angler who is in the area for a fishing tournament had an estimated $15,000 worth of fishing equipment stolen from his truck on Labor Day Monday.

His wife noticed the equipment missing after she stopped at several Lufkin-area stores. She believes the theft occurred at either Walmart or Academy because she parked at the back of the parking lot at both locations. The fishing gear was taken from the couple’s 2004, blue Chevy ¾ ton pickup with a matching camper on the back.

Lufkin Police are working with management at both stores to retrieve parking lot video which will hopefully identify the suspect or suspects.

Anyone with information is asked to contact the Department at 936-633-0356 or Crime Stoppers at 936-639-TIPS.
